Free and first-come, first-served, Chevelon Canyon Lake Campground sits within Sitgreaves National Forest along FR 169B, where the final half-mile of road has washed out sections and steep drop-offs that require high-clearance vehicles. No potable water is available on-site. Sites are large, include fire rings and metal picnic tables, and vault toilets are provided. The campground stays busy even on non-holiday weekends, so arriving early matters. Anglers should note that live bait is not permitted at the lake, and the hike down to the water covers more than a mile with roughly 550 feet of elevation loss, making the return a demanding climb. Pack all water and carry out all trash.
